What are Banking Terms?

Banking terms are words that are commonly used in banks and financial services. They explain different banking activities such as deposits, loans, interest, payments and digital banking. 10 Important Banking Terms with Simple Meaning For SBI PO, IBPS PO & Other Bank Exams

Given below are some of the important banking terms with simple meanings for exams like SBI PO, IBPS PO and Other Bank Exams 2026:-

Terms

Meaning

Savings Account 

It is a bank account where people keep their money safe and also earn interest on this account.

Fixed Deposit

This is where people keep money in a bank for a fixed period of time to earn a higher rate of interest.

EMI (Equated Monthly Instalment)

This is a fixed monthly payment which is made to the bank to repay a loan which has been taken out by the customer.

NEFT

NEFT is a system which is used to transfer money electronically from one bank account to another 

Repo Rate

It is the interest rate at which the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) lends short-term money to commercial banks.

Cash Reserve Ratio

It is the minimum percentage of total deposits that banks must keep as cash with the RBI.

Statutory Liquidity Ratio

Statutory Liquidity Ratio (SLR) is the minimum percentage of deposits that banks must maintain in safe assets like cash, gold, or approved government securities before lending.

RTGS

It is a fund transfer system that is used mainly for large-value money transfers like Rs. 2,00,000. It stands for Real-Time Gross Settlement

Reverse Reop Rate

It is the interest rate at which the RBI pays banks when they deposit their excess money with the Central Bank.

Bank Rate

Bank Rate is the standard interest rate at which the RBI Charges commercial banks for long-term loans.
